How To Implement Data Observability

Data has become the backbone of modern decision-making, powering everything from real-time analytics to AI-driven solutions. However, as data pipelines grow increasingly complex, ensuring data reliability, quality, and transparency is more critical than ever. This is where data observability comes in.
Data observability is the ability to monitor, diagnose, and resolve data issues by gaining comprehensive insights into the health of your data systems. It involves tracking and analyzing metrics across your data pipeline to ensure accurate, complete, and timely data delivery.
This guide will walk you through what data observability is, why it’s essential, and the key steps to implementing it in your organization.
Data observability refers to the practices, tools, and processes used to understand the state of your data systems at any given time. Similar to observability in software engineering, data observability focuses on monitoring metrics, logs, and metadata to detect anomalies, prevent downtime, and maintain trust in data.
The five pillars of data observability are:
Without robust observability, organizations risk operating on flawed data, leading to inaccurate insights and potentially damaging business decisions. Some key benefits of implementing data observability include:
By continuously monitoring for anomalies and inconsistencies, data observability ensures that your pipelines deliver high-quality data.
When data issues arise, observability tools provide granular insights to quickly identify and resolve the root cause.
For industries with strict data regulations (e.g., healthcare, finance), observability ensures data pipelines meet legal and compliance standards.
Teams spend less time firefighting data issues and more time focusing on strategic initiatives.
Stakeholders gain confidence in data accuracy, enabling better decision-making.
Implementing data observability requires a structured approach that aligns with your organization’s data architecture and goals. Here are the key steps:
Before implementing observability, it is essential to identify specific challenges or pain points in your data ecosystem. These goals should align with business objectives and address the most critical issues affecting your pipelines.
For example:
Implementing data observability requires strategic planning, the right tools, and cross-functional collaboration. Clearly defining these challenges helps you focus your observability efforts and ensures alignment across teams.
By mapping the entire data lifecycle, you can identify critical points where monitoring and observability tools should be implemented. A clear understanding of your data ecosystem is foundational to observability. This involves documenting all data sources, pipelines, storage solutions, and downstream applications.
Here’s an example of a detailed map of your data architecture:
Understanding the full data lifecycle helps identify critical points for observability.
Choose tools that align with your ecosystem and observability goals. Modern data observability platforms, such as Monte Carlo, Datadog, or OpenTelemetry, offer features like anomaly detection, lineage tracking, and real-time monitoring.
Look for tools that provide:
Instrumentation involves embedding monitoring capabilities within your data pipelines. This step ensures that key metrics, such as data freshness and transformation success rates, are continuously tracked and logged. Metadata collection, including schema details and transformation histories, is also essential for building a complete picture of pipeline behavior.
Here are examples of how instrumentation embeds monitoring capabilities into your pipelines:
Instrumentation embeds monitoring in data pipelines, tracking metrics like freshness and success rates. Collecting logs, metrics, and metadata provides a complete view of pipeline performance.
To detect anomalies, you need to establish what "normal" looks like in your data ecosystem. Baselines define expected patterns, such as average data volume or standard update intervals.
By setting thresholds for acceptable variations, your observability tools can identify outliers and raise alerts when these limits are breached. Here are acceptable ranges to establish for your key metrics:
Baselines enable anomaly detection by flagging deviations from normal behavior.
Timely notifications are critical for addressing data issues before they escalate. Observability tools should integrate with your organization’s alerting and incident management systems, such as Slack, PagerDuty, or Jira.
Alerts should be actionable, meaning they provide enough context to help teams prioritize and address the issue quickly. This ensures that stakeholders are immediately notified of critical issues, such as:
Alerts should be actionable and prioritized based on severity.
Fostering a culture of data observability requires organizational buy-in, collaboration, and shared accountability. To build this culture and prioritize data quality:
By aligning efforts between data engineers, analysts, and business users, organizations can ensure data health and reliability.
Data observability is a continuous process. As your data ecosystem evolves, so must your observability framework. Regularly review the effectiveness of your tools and processes, and make adjustments based on new challenges or business requirements. Additionally, monitor improvements in pipeline reliability and resolution times to measure the success of your observability efforts.
Continuously monitor the effectiveness of your observability framework and refine it based on:
Implementing data observability effectively ensures the health and reliability of your data ecosystem. Follow these best practices:
These practices help ensure consistent, high-quality data for better decision-making.
Data observability plays a vital role in maintaining the health and reliability of data systems. Key use cases include:
By addressing these scenarios, data observability helps organizations maximize the value of their data assets.
By implementing a robust observability framework, organizations can ensure data reliability, streamline operations, and build trust in their analytics and AI systems. Start small, leverage modern tools, and focus on continuous improvement to unlock the full potential of your data observability efforts. With the right approach, your organization will be well-positioned to navigate the complexities of modern data pipelines and achieve long-term success.
Discover how healthcare leaders are scaling data governance with automation, centralized metadata, and smarter workflows. Learn why modern governance is key to AI readiness, compliance, and secure innovation.